Iowa was handed a crushing defeat at home by the Iowa State Cyclones. Figuratively and quite literally, it dampened Hawkeye fans’ feelings about what 2022 might have in store.

Afterwards, Iowa head football coach Kirk Ferentz had this to say about his group’s performance.

“Obviously, all of us are disappointed with the loss. Congratulations to our opponent. I thought our guys played with good effort and were ready to go. We got off to a really good start, positive start, and then from there things didn’t work out so well, obviously.

“I thought our guys really worked hard, missed some opportunities. Not that there were a lot of them, but the ones that were there, couldn’t cash in. Did a lot of good things on defense certainly and a lot of big special teams plays, and then stating the obvious, we have work to do, obviously, to move the football, and we’re going to have to score points to be successful. That’s where our focus goes.

“Just got a locker room full of guys that are really invested, that play hard, that care about each other. Don’t have many answers right now other than we go back to work tomorrow and see what we can figure out and try to move forward,” Ferentz said.
